[0001] This utility model relates to the field of damping sound insulation board production technology, specifically a pressing device for producing damping sound insulation boards. Background Technology

[0002] Currently, the best sound insulation board is a type of damping sound insulation board with a constrained damping structure. It is formed by sandwiching a layer of high-polymer damping material between two building materials, such as gypsum board, magnesium oxide board, calcium silicate board, or cement-pressed fiberboard. This type of board is a preferred new material in the field of green building. When sound impacts the damping sound insulation board, the board vibrates. The damping material suppresses the propagation of this vibration, reducing sound transmission and reflection through the board, effectively reducing noise.

[0003] A pressing device is required in the production process of damping sound insulation panels. Chinese utility model patent CN210551956U discloses a sheet metal pressing device, including a frame. A base is fixedly installed at the bottom of the frame. An inverted electro-hydraulic push rod is installed on a structural plate at the top of the frame, penetrating the structural plate. A mounting bracket is fixedly installed on the outer wall of the bottom of the outer cylinder of the electro-hydraulic push rod. The mounting bracket is connected to the structural plate at the top of the frame by mounting bolts. A pressure sensor is installed in the gap between the top of the mounting bracket and the bottom of the structural plate. This utility model, by installing an electro-hydraulic push rod on the top structural plate of the frame, with a mounting bracket at the bottom of the outer cylinder of the electro-hydraulic push rod, and the mounting bracket connected to the top structural plate of the frame by mounting bolts, allows the device to compress the wood chip mixture placed in the mold frame when the electro-hydraulic push rod extends.

[0004] However, during the use of this utility model, the sound insulation board needs to be manually placed inside the mold frame during the pressing process. At this time, the hand is at the bottom of the lower pressure plate, which increases the safety risk for the workers and cannot meet the production needs. Therefore, a pressing device for producing damping sound insulation boards is proposed to solve the problems mentioned above. Utility Model Content

[0005] To address the shortcomings of existing technologies, this utility model provides a pressing device for the production of damping sound insulation panels, which has the advantage of increasing the safety of workers. It solves the problem that existing pressing devices require manual placement of the sound insulation panel inside the mold frame during the pressing process, at which point the hand is at the bottom of the lower pressing plate, thus increasing the safety risk for workers.

[0024] Please see Figures 1 to 3This embodiment of a pressing device for producing damping sound insulation panels includes a workbench 1 and a mounting plate 2 disposed on the top of the workbench 1. A linkage pushing mechanism is provided between the workbench 1 and the mounting plate 2 to facilitate loading and unloading by workers. The linkage pushing mechanism includes a placement platform 6 slidably connected to the upper surface of the workbench 1. Fixed seats 7 are fixedly connected to the left and right sides of the top of the workbench 1. A rotating plate 8 extending to its front is rotatably connected inside the fixed seat 7. Movable blocks 9 extending into the rotating plate 8 are fixedly connected to the left and right sides of the placement platform 6. A mounting frame 10 is rotatably connected inside the fixed seat 7. A roller 11 is rotatably connected inside the mounting frame 10. A pressing mechanism capable of pressing down on the roller 11 is provided on the top of the mounting plate 2.

[0025] Specifically, the pressing mechanism includes a telescopic cylinder 3 fixedly installed on the top of the mounting plate 2 and extending to its bottom. A connecting plate 4 is fixedly connected to the output end of the telescopic cylinder 3. A pressing plate 5 is fixedly connected to the side of the connecting plate 4 near the placement platform 6. A pressing plate 12 that contacts the roller 11 is fixedly connected to the bottom of the connecting plate 4. A slider extending into the worktable 1 is fixedly connected to the bottom of the placement platform 6. A slide rail that is slidably connected to the slider is fixedly installed inside the worktable 1. An active groove 13 that matches the active block 9 is opened inside the rotating plate 8. The rotating plate 8 is fixedly connected to the opposite side of the mounting frame 10.

[0026] It should be noted that a positioning guide rod 14 is fixedly connected between the workbench 1 and the mounting top plate 2, and a support spring 15 is fixedly connected between the connecting plate 4 and the workbench 1. The support spring 15 is slidably connected to the outside of the positioning guide rod 14. The connection between the connecting plate 4 and the positioning guide rod 14 is a sliding connection. There are four positioning guide rods 14, which are evenly distributed on the top of the workbench 1.

[0027] It should be noted that a torsion spring is installed inside the fixed base 7. When the rotating plate 8 rotates, the torsion spring will undergo elastic deformation. Then, when the pressure plate 12 moves upward, the rotating plate 8 and the mounting bracket 10 can be reset, thereby resetting the placement platform 6. This makes it convenient for workers to remove the sound insulation board. Throughout the process, the workers' hands are always in front of the pressing plate 5, which greatly reduces the safety hazards for workers.

[0028] Please see Figure 1 and Figure 4 In this embodiment, a support frame 16 is fixedly connected to the upper surface of the placement platform 6. A threaded rod 17 extending into the top of the support frame 16 is threadedly connected to it. A positioning plate 18 is rotatably connected to the bottom end of the threaded rod 17. A rotating handle 19 is fixedly connected to the end of the threaded rod 17 away from the positioning plate 18.

[0029] Specifically, the support frame 16 is in the shape of an inverted L, and there are two support frames 16 symmetrically distributed on the left and right sides of the top of the placement platform 6.

[0030] It should be noted that by rotating the rotating handle 19, the threaded rod 17 is rotated and moved downwards. At this time, the positioning plate 18 moves downwards, thereby positioning the sound insulation board and preventing it from shifting during the pressing process.

[0031] The working principle of the above embodiments is as follows:

[0032] First, the staff places the sound insulation board to be pressed on the placement platform 6. Then, they rotate the rotating handle 19 to move the positioning plate 18 downwards, pressing the sound insulation board into place. Next, the staff activates the telescopic cylinder 3 to move the connecting plate 4 downwards. At this time, the rotating plate 8 rotates, moving the placement platform 6 backwards. Simultaneously, the pressing plate 5 moves downwards, thus achieving the pressing process of the sound insulation board. After pressing is completed, the connecting plate 4 moves upwards, and the placement platform 6 moves forwards, allowing the sound insulation board to be removed.
